Job OverviewThe Food & Beverage Manager is responsible for overseeing all food and beverage operations within the lodge, ensuring exceptional guest experiences, efficient service delivery, and strong financial performance. This role manages restaurant, bar, kitchen coordination, stock control, and service standards in line with hospitality excellence. Key ResponsibilitiesOperational ManagementOversee daily food and beverage operations (restaurant, bar, and dining experiences)Ensure seamless coordination between kitchen and front-of-house teamsMaintain high service standards and guest satisfaction at all timesManage dining schedules, special events, and guest requirementsGuest ExperienceInteract with guests to ensure exceptional service deliveryHandle guest feedback, complaints, and special requests professionallyEnsure personalized and memorable dining experiencesStaff ManagementRecruit, train, and supervise F&B staffManage staff rosters, attendance, and performanceConduct regular training on service standards, hygiene, and product knowledgeFoster a positive and professional team environmentStock Control & ProcurementOversee stock control, ordering, and inventory managementMinimize wastage and control costs effectivelyWork closely with suppliers and ensure quality of productsFinancial ManagementMonitor budgets, food costs, and beverage costsAnalyze sales and implement strategies to improve revenueEnsure all POS systems and cash handling procedures are followedHealth & Safety ComplianceEnsure compliance with food safety and hygiene standardsMaintain cleanliness and organization in all F&B areasEnsure adherence to health, safety, and licensing regulationsReporting & AdministrationPrepare daily, weekly, and monthly reportsMonitor KPIs and operational performanceEnsure accurate record-keeping and documentation
